The catastrophic flash floods near the Nepal-Tibet border are believed to have been triggered by a glacier collapse caused by climate change. The floods have resulted in nearly 3,000 people missing and over 600 confirmed deaths in Nepal, with additional casualties reported in Tibet. Rescue efforts are ongoing amid challenging weather conditions, and Nepal estimates needing up to $5 billion for recovery.
